How to Say Gray in Spanish: A Comprehensive Guide

The word "gris" is used across the Spanish-speaking world to describe the color that falls between black and white. In some regions, such as Mexico, gray may be referred to as gris claro (Light gray) or gris oscuro (Dark gray), depending on the shade.

How to Say Gray in Spanish: Sample Sentences

To help you understand how "gris" is used in context, here are five sample sentences:

  • El pelaje del gato es gris.
  • (The cat's fur is gray.)

  • Pintó las paredes en un hermoso tono de gris.
  • (She painted the walls in a beautiful shade of gray.)

  • El cielo tormentoso lucía gris y amenazante.
  • (The stormy sky appeared gray and ominous.)

  • Su cabello está empezando a volverse gris debido a la edad.
  • (His hair is starting to turn gray due to age.)
